OVERNIGHT (English. overnight)

OVERNIGHT (English. overnight) - transaction “Overnight”, that is, valid from the current trading or banking day to the next, and during the weekends (days off) - from Friday to Monday.

Market On Close (MOC) order is an order, which can be sent during the day during the trading session, but will be executed in the last trade at close. Throughout the trading day, exchanges accumulate MOC orders and bring them together in the last trade (print) trading day. After-hours trading – execution of transactions with securities after the close of the exchange session. Previously, this type of trade using special computer systems was used by, mainly, institutional traders. Many online brokers today offer access to “last day trading” a wide range of investors. Ask (asked price) – Selling price – seller's asking price, ie. the lowest price, by which he is ready to sell. At-the-opening order – order to the broker to conclude a deal at the best price at the opening of the exchange (at the beginning of the morning session).
